Prep Time:30 mins
Cook Time:5 mins
Total Time:35 mins
Servings: 4

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 3 whole large eggs
  • 0.5 teaspoons salt
  • 2 tablespoons water
  • 1 teaspoon unsalted butter

Directions

Step 1

In a large mixing bowl, combine the all-purpose flour and salt.

Step 2

Create a well in the center of the dry ingredients and crack the eggs into the well.

Step 3

Add the water and unsalted butter to the eggs.

Step 4

Using a fork or your fingers, gently mix the eggs and water, gradually incorporating the flour until all ingredients form a shaggy dough.

Step 5

Transfer the dough onto a floured surface and knead it for 8-10 minutes, or until the dough is smooth and elastic.

Step 6

Wrap the dough in plastic wrap or cover it with a damp towel, letting it rest for 20 minutes at room temperature.

Step 7

After resting, divide the dough into 4 equal portions. Roll out one portion at a time on a floured surface to your desired thickness (about 1/8-inch for thicker noodles or 1/16-inch for thinner noodles).

Step 8

Using a sharp knife or pizza cutter, slice the rolled dough into strips of your desired width (about 1/4-inch wide for traditional noodles). Repeat with the remaining dough portions.

Step 9

Lay the cut noodles out in a single layer on a floured baking sheet or clean kitchen towel to prevent sticking.

Step 10

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add the noodles, stirring gently to separate them, and cook for 2-5 minutes, depending on the thickness, until tender but still slightly firm.

Step 11

Drain the noodles and serve immediately with your favorite sauce, in soup, or with a drizzle of olive oil or melted butter.
